import PropTypes from 'prop-types' import React from 'react' import UnitTabsComponent from './UnitTabsComponent' import DeleteMachine from './DeleteMachine' import { TextContent, TextList, TextListItem, TextListItemVariants, TextListVariants, Title, } from '@patternfly/react-core' import { useSelector } from 'react-redux' function MachineSidebar({ tileId, position }) { const machine = useSelector(({ objects }) => { const rack = objects.rack[objects.tile[tileId].rack] return objects.machine[rack.machines[position - 1]] }) const machineId = machine._id return (